Flowmaster 40 Muffler + Seafoam Treatment
Bought myself a can of seafoam from Napa today. Poored half of it into the vacuum line attached to the brake booster, the other half into the gas tank. I let it sit for 15~ minutes before I tried starting it back up again; When I drove home today, about a 20 minute city drive, I noticed immediately better throttle response, better pickup, and the engine runs smoother. Its this first time ive ever done it, not sure how well maintained the engine was before I bought the truck so I figured I might aswell try it. Im glad i did. Ill have to see if it gets any better milage now that Ive cleaned it. Im going to wait a few days though, gas is almost 1.10/l. (4.50~ a gal).
